加速行動版網頁 Accelerated Mobile Pages AMP
加速行動版網頁 Accelerated Mobile Pages AMP
由 Google 推出的 Framework 可以讓行動網站快速載入,在 Search Console 也會看到一些有關 Webmaster 使用與提交
結構
AMP 的三大組成
- AMP HTML
- 有些特規標籤 如 “
, 等”
- 有些特規標籤 如 “
- AMP JS
- 只能使用 AMP 元件不能夠使用自己或是第三方的 JS,真的要用必須洗在 Sandboxed iframe
- AMP Cache
- 會放在 Google AMP Cache 並顯示在 Google Search 的 Top Stories 版位
Pros/Cons
Pros
- 載入快
- 跨瀏覽器支援
- 在 Google Top Stories 顯示快速瀏覽,吸引使用者
Cons
- 限制太多
- 基本靜態
- 外部資源使用必須選宣告,避免 Load 太久
- 外部字體,大小限制以及引入位置,也不能用 inline
- 只能用 GPU 加入的動畫
- 會對下載資源進行優先順序的管控 比如圖檔與廣告會 Lazy load
參考文章
- 加速行動版網頁(AMP, Accelerated Mobile Pages)